The Kenya Revenue Authority (KRA) will play a key logistical role upon construction of a major road connecting the horn of Africa countries. The road, under the banner Horn of Africa Gateway Development Project (HoAGDP), was launched in Isiolo town.

According to MS Lilian Nyawanda, Commissioner for Customs and Border Control, KRA’s role is to facilitate faster movement of goods (imports & Exports) and persons at the Kenya/Ethiopia border, facilitate cross-border trade between Kenya and Somalia (upon opening of the borders), electronically monitor cargo along the Isiolo-Mandera route, secure cargo along the route and simplify cross-border trade between Kenya and neighboring countries.

“KRA through Customs will operationalize the One Stop Border Post (OSBP) to facilitate trade between Kenya and neighboring countries and geo-fence the Isiolo-Mandera Route to facilitate electronic monitoring of cargo along the route. Additionally, KRA will establish Rapid Response Unit (RRU)Offices along the route to complement the electronic cargo tracking system, “said Nyawanda

Other KRA initiatives along the new road, according to Commissioner Nyawanda include; installation of Cargo Surveillance Systems, installation of Smart Gates at Rhamu and Mandera OSBP, deployment of enforcement equipment like Surveillance drones, Motor Vehicles and Drug detection equipment.
